India’s no. 1 paddler Sreeja Akula advances to the Round of 32 of Paris Olympics 2024

India’s no. 1 paddler won her first game against Christina Kallberg in the Paris Olympics 2024 to advance to the Round of 32.

New Delhi: India’s no. 1 paddler won her first game against Christina Kallberg in the Paris Olympics 2024 to advance to the Round of 32. It was a walk in the park for the young paddler who has become one of the popular names in the Indian Table Tennis circle.


Kallberg came out with attacking intent and was rather relentless with her approach. However, the backhand defence and front-hand attack shots kept things simple for herself. Earlier, Sreeja had scripted history to become the first paddler to win the WTT Contender singles title.

Sreeja in Round of 32

Akula who is India’s number 1 paddler won an easy game against the Swedish paddler to wrap up the game in 28 minutes! The final scoreline was 11-4, 11-9, 11-7, 11-8 to complete the whitewash inside 4 sets.


Sreeja will face her next opponent in the Round of 32 on the 30th of July. The Indian paddler started things in style before being stretched in the second set. Things got spiced up in the third set as the Swedish paddler went neck-to-neck to take a 9-3 lead. But a few good shots from Akula turned things in favour of Sreeja.
